Just a heads-up to all of you who opened or are planning to open a Club account to your Macy's card in anticipation of the line merger in July: this account is NOT a hidden TL like the Special Events and Major Purchases accounts appear to be. I was approved for both the Major Purchases and Club lines earlier this month, and my account statement cut yesterday and was updated to CCBs by this morning. From my Experian report, I can see one new Macy's account opened 5/15 with a CL of $10k (that's the Club); my Special Events continues to be hidden, and my Major Purchases is also invisible.
So when the line merger happens in a few months, this visible Club TL will show as closed while my other visible Macy's TL (the revolving line) will have the new consolidated CL. I'm a little bummed that this'll affect my AAoA in a way I didn't expect, but what's done is done. But if any of you who were thinking about the Club account and are concerned about AAoA and number of new accounts, you may want to take pause.
